12 days before the film’s scheduled wide release, Amazon Prime members are getting a multi-city, one day-only exclusive early screening of “Jumanji: Welcome to The Jungle.”
The early showings will take place Dec. 8 at 7:00 p.m. local time in more than 1,000 Regal, AMC, ArcLight Cinemas, and National Amusements theaters nationwide. Prime members will be able to purchase up to 10 tickets, beginning today at www.amazon.com/Jumanji.
The Prime-exclusive early screening is the first of its kind for the streaming service. At a limited number of theaters participating in the event, Prime members will receive a ‘blue carpet’ experience, in which they’ll have the opportunity to receive devices using Amazon’s Prime Now delivery service, a Jumanji themed photo booth, gift bags, Whole Foods gift cards, and other giveaways and promotions to be announced.
A sequel to the 1995 film “Jumanji” that updates the original board game concept, “Jumanji: Welcome to the Jungle” sees four teenagers sucked into a video game world they must play through to the end in order to survive. Directed by Jake Kasdan and written by Chris McKenna & Erik Sommers and Scott Rosenberg & Jeff Pinkner, Dwayne Johnson, Jack Black, Kevin Hart, and Karen Gillan star.
“Jumanji: Welcome to the Jungle” hits theaters Dec. 20.
